A mid 19th Century Sycamore Lemon Squeezer, having a design similar to a straw splitter, with a rounded and tapered body ending in four blades for inserting into the fruit. The whole has a pale colour and retains a patination.
Provenance: Reckless Collection.
English Circa 1840.
